Abstract: PURPOSE: To correct the position of a peak located at a predetermined position of a read-out signal while suppressing deterioration in S/N ratio. CONSTITUTION: A comparator 36 determines the shifting direction of a peak located in the center with respect to the original position thereof from threshold levels corresponding to the magnitude of three continuous peaks of an RBS detected by a circuit 26 according to the relationship of magnitude between |AMP-1 -AMP0 | and |AMP0 -AMP1 | assuming the magnitude of three peaks are AMP-1 , AMP0 and AMP1 and outputs a pulse indicative of the shifting direction to an FIFO 38. A delay circuit 44 outputs a plurality of pulses being shifted by an amount corresponding to the threshold level based on the input timing of a PDS. An MUX 40 selects the output pulse from the delay circuit 44 based on the pulse indicative of the shifting direction from the FIFO 38 and |AMP-1 -AMP1 | detected by an amplitude difference detection circuit 100.

Abstract: PROBLEM TO BE SOLVED: To easily detect the error caused by thermal asperity by controlling a recording and reproducing means and executing an error recovery processing without conducting a compensation by a compensating means when an error is detected in a recording and reproducing operation. SOLUTION: An arm electronic circuit (AE) 3 is provided with a signal adaptive filter 3a. The SAF 3a reduces the adverse effect caused by thermal asperity (TA) through eliminating the low frequency components of the reproduced output of a head 2, for example. Note that the operation of the SAF 3a is made controllable from an MPU 7, the SAF 3a is invalidated while executing an ERP, and TA is positively detected. By adding a step which invalidates the operation of the SAF3a that compensates for the reproduced output of the head 2 during an error recovery processing, thermal asperity is easily detected and the data sector, in which TA is generated, is surely registered as a defective sector.

Abstract: PROBLEM TO BE SOLVED: To provide a disk type recording medium, a disk drive device, and the like that yield can be improved, complexness of control can be reduced, and reduction of performance can be suppressed. SOLUTION: Recording line density of a recording plane (e.g. 1c) of which a software error rate(SER) is bad is reduced, and recording line density of recording planes (e.g. 1a, 1b, 1d, 1e, 1f) of which SER is not so bad is increased. A control section 4e or a control section 5a changes a table in accordance with recording line density of each recording plane 1a-1f at the time of recording and reproducing, and changes recording and reproducing characteristics.
